What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R  1910.134(c)(2)(i): Respirator users were not provided with the information contained in Appendix D to 29 CFR 1910.134 when the employer determined that any voluntary respirator use was permissible: (Construction Reference 1926.103)  The employee voluntarily wearing a half face respirator while conducting welding activities did not have a signed appendix D. The employee was exposed to respiratory hazards.

29 CFR  1910.1200(g)(8):  The employer did not maintain in the workplace copies of the required safety data sheets for each hazardous chemical.   The Safety Data Sheets for chemicals used on site including the Hobart Filler Metals welding rods were not maintained on site. Employees were exposed to chemicals hazards.

29 CFR  1926.403(b)(2): Listed, labeled, or certified equipment was not installed and used in accordance with instructions included in the listing, labeling, or certification:  First Floor: Throughout the first floor temporary lights were powered by multiple extension cords connected in-series with splitter cords to create more connections for all of the lights. Employees were exposed to electrical and fire hazards.

29 CFR  1926.405(b)(1): Unused openings in cabinets, boxes, and fittings were not effectively closed:  First floor back of warehouse: The panel box on the wall  in the back of the warehouse had missing knockouts. Employees were exposed to electrical hazards.
